Income Statement Key Figures

Revenue and Revenue Growth

Revenue is the starting point of every income statement — it measures the total sales Goosehead Insurance generates from its core business. Revenue growth (expressed as year-over-year percentage change) is one of the most important indicators of business momentum. Sustained growth above 10 % annually is generally considered strong, while declining revenue is a serious warning sign that demands investigation.

Gross Margin

Gross margin = (Revenue − Cost of Goods Sold) ÷ Revenue. It reveals what percentage of each dollar of revenue Goosehead Insurance retains after direct production costs. High gross margins (above 50 %) are typical of asset-light businesses like software and brands, while capital-intensive industries like manufacturing often operate below 30 %. Compare Goosehead Insurance's gross margin to industry peers and track it over time to spot improving or deteriorating pricing power.

EBIT and EBIT Margin

EBIT measures operating profit — what remains after subtracting all operating expenses (including R&D, sales, and administrative costs) from gross profit. The EBIT margin shows this as a percentage of revenue. Because it excludes interest and taxes, EBIT allows fair comparisons between companies with different debt levels and tax jurisdictions. A rising EBIT margin indicates improving operational efficiency.

Net Income and Earnings Per Share (EPS)

Net income is the company's final profit after all expenses, interest, and taxes. Dividing net income by the number of shares outstanding gives you EPS — the single most influential metric in stock valuation. Consistent EPS growth is the primary driver of long-term stock price appreciation. Always check whether EPS growth comes from genuine profit improvement or from share buybacks reducing the share count.

Shares Outstanding

The total number of shares Goosehead Insurance has issued. A declining share count (through buybacks) boosts EPS and signals management confidence. A rising share count (through stock issuance) dilutes existing shareholders. Always monitor this number alongside EPS to get the full picture of per-share value creation.

Goosehead Insurance business model & stock analysis

Goosehead Insurance Inc is an American company that operates as an independent insurance intermediary. The company, headquartered in Westlake, Texas, was founded in 2003 by Robyn Jones and Mark E. Jones. The founders aimed to change the traditional model of insurance agencies. Through the use of modern technology, the creation of tailored insurance plans, and exceptional customer service, the company quickly gained recognition. Goosehead Insurance Inc's business model is focused on offering its customers the best insurance offers on the market. As an independent intermediary, the company works with numerous insurance companies in the United States. This allows them to provide a wide range of insurance options that are tailored to their customers' needs and preferences. Goosehead Insurance Inc operates in various areas, including auto, home, life, and business insurance. With a diverse portfolio of offerings, the company can help its customers obtain all necessary insurance coverage. In the auto insurance sector, Goosehead Insurance Inc offers various options, including liability and comprehensive insurance, both of which provide coverage for damages to other vehicles or property in the event of an accident. Comprehensive insurance also offers additional coverage for damages to one's own vehicle. In the home insurance sector, the company offers insurance for both single-family homes and apartments. The insurance policies cover damages to the residence or property and the customers' belongings. In the life insurance sector, Goosehead Insurance Inc offers various types of policies, including permanent and term insurance. Permanent insurance provides constant coverage over a longer period of time, while term insurance offers coverage for a specific period, such as 10 or 20 years. In the business insurance sector, Goosehead Insurance Inc offers various options, including insurance for commercial liability protection and transportation insurance. Business customers can discuss their specific insurance needs with the company to receive a customized package. Another important factor of Goosehead Insurance Inc is its customer service. The company ensures that its customers receive the best possible support. Individual needs and preferences are taken into account to find the best insurance solution. Customers can contact the company through various channels and receive prompt and professional assistance. By successfully implementing its business model, Goosehead Insurance Inc has become a key player in the insurance market. The company has over 1,000 employees and works with a variety of insurance companies to offer its customers a comprehensive selection of insurance options. Overall, Goosehead Insurance Inc offers a modern and innovative way to obtain insurance coverage. The company has improved a traditional business model through the use of new technologies and a high level of customer service. Customers are provided with a wide range of insurance options tailored to their individual needs.

Goosehead Insurance SWOT Analysis

Strengths

Goosehead Insurance Inc has several key strengths that contribute to its success in the insurance industry. Firstly, the company offers a wide range of insurance products, including home, auto, and life insurance, providing a comprehensive solution for customers' insurance needs. This diverse portfolio allows Goosehead Insurance to attract a larger customer base and offer attractive bundled packages.

Secondly, Goosehead Insurance differentiates itself through its innovative and technology-driven approach. The company has developed user-friendly online platforms and mobile apps, making it easier for customers to access and manage their policies. This technological advantage enhances customer convenience and satisfaction, giving Goosehead Insurance a competitive edge in the digital era.

Furthermore, Goosehead Insurance takes pride in its highly-trained and professional insurance agents. The company invests in continuous training and development programs to ensure that its agents possess in-depth knowledge and expertise. This expertise, coupled with exceptional customer service, sets Goosehead Insurance apart from its competitors.

Weaknesses

While Goosehead Insurance Inc has numerous strengths, it also faces certain weaknesses that could hinder its growth and success. One apparent weakness is its relatively limited brand recognition compared to well-established competitors in the insurance market. Building brand awareness and credibility among potential customers may require substantial marketing investments.

Additionally, Goosehead Insurance relies heavily on its network of independent franchisees and agents. While this decentralized structure allows for a wider geographic presence, it also poses challenges in maintaining consistent service quality across all locations. Ensuring consistent customer experiences and operational standards will be critical for Goosehead Insurance's long-term success.

Opportunities

Goosehead Insurance Inc operates in a market with several growth opportunities. One notable opportunity arises from the increasing awareness and demand for insurance coverage, driven by factors such as population growth, new homeownership, and evolving regulatory requirements. Capturing a larger market share in these expanding segments can fuel Goosehead Insurance's growth.

Furthermore, advancements in technology offer Goosehead Insurance the chance to enhance its digital capabilities further. Customized insurance solutions, improved data analytics, and streamlined claims processes are just a few areas where innovation can help the company gain a competitive advantage.

Threats

Several threats could impact the success of Goosehead Insurance Inc. One significant threat is intense competition within the insurance industry. Established insurance companies have substantial resources and well-established customer bases, making it challenging for Goosehead Insurance to gain market share. Staying ahead in this competitive landscape will require continuous innovation and effective marketing strategies.

Moreover, the unpredictable nature of external factors such as economic downturns, natural disasters, and regulatory changes poses risks to Goosehead Insurance's operations. Adapting to sudden shifts in market conditions and effectively managing risks will be crucial to mitigate these external threats.

What This Chart Shows

This chart breaks down 's total annual return into two components: price return (gains or losses from stock price movement) and dividend return (income received from dividend payments). Together, they represent the total return an investor would have earned in each calendar year.

Price Return

Price return measures the percentage change in 's stock price from January 1st to December 31st of each year. Positive bars indicate the stock appreciated; negative bars show a decline. This is the component most investors focus on, but it tells only part of the story — especially for dividend-paying stocks.

Dividend Return

Dividend return represents the income generated from dividends paid during the year, expressed as a percentage of the starting stock price. While it may seem small in any single year (typically 1–4 % for established companies), dividends compound significantly over decades and have historically contributed roughly 40 % of total stock market returns.

What to Look For

Examine how many years showed positive vs. negative returns to gauge consistency. A stock with mostly positive years and small drawdowns suggests lower risk. Also compare 's annual returns to a benchmark index — consistently outperforming the market is a hallmark of a strong investment. Pay attention to the worst years: understanding downside risk is just as important as chasing upside potential.
